AI-analyzed exploit summary This exploit demonstrates two vulnerabilities in Apache Syncope 2.0.7: RCE via XSLT injection in Reports/Templates and information disclosure via FIQL/ORDER BY sorting. The XSLT payloads show file read and command execution, while the FIQL/ORDER BY technique recovers sensitive data like security answers.
Description
An administrator with report and template entitlements in Apache Syncope 1.2.x before 1.2.11, 2.0.x before 2.0.8, and unsupported releases 1.0.x and 1.1.x which may be also affected, can use XSL Transformations (XSLT) to perform malicious operations, including but not limited to file read, file write, and code execution.
